Liverpool want Real Madrid star Luka Modrić – REPORTS

Luka Modric

Reports originating from Spain claim that Liverpool want to sign Real Madrid’s Luka Modrić.

It is claimed that the Reds want to sign the 32-year-old former Spurs man following suggestions that he wants to return to the Premier League.

If reports are to be believed, Modrić is looking for a move to London with Arsenal reportedly showing interest.

The claims are very speculative and we’re not convinced that Reds’ boss Jürgen Klopp would be looking at a 32-year-old who is coming to the end of his career when he already a has a number of options at his disposal including the incoming Naby Keïta.

Meanwhile, Juventus appear to have accepted that Emre Can won’t be making a decision about his future until the season has concluded.

The Liverpool midfielder has failed to agree a new contract with Liverpool and is expected to make the switch to the Italian giants on a free transfer in the summer. Although free to sign a pre-contract with them since January 1st, the Germany international says he won’t be making any decisions until the summer as he wants to focus on his football.

Juventus managing director Beppe Marotta commented: “We are not going to have a final reply anytime soon.

“He is a top player and many clubs want to sign him. He is available as a free agent.

“We’ve already made our move but his reply is not going to arrive anytime soon.”
